Concrete foundation leveling services involve the process of correcting uneven or sinking concrete slabs to restore stability and proper alignment. This typically includes assessing the foundation’s condition, then using specialized techniques to lift and support the concrete. The goal is to prevent further settling, reduce structural stress, and improve the safety and appearance of the property. These services often utilize equipment such as hydraulic jacks, polyurethane foam, or mudjacking materials to raise and stabilize the affected areas effectively.
This service addresses common problems associated with foundation issues, such as cracked or uneven flooring, cracked walls, and doors or windows that no longer close properly. When the foundation shifts or sinks, it can cause significant damage to a property’s structural integrity and aesthetic appeal. Concrete foundation leveling helps mitigate these issues by restoring the original level and stability of the concrete surfaces, thereby reducing the risk of further damage and costly repairs down the line.

What causes uneven concrete slabs? Uneven concrete slabs can result from soil settling, erosion, or improper initial installation, leading to foundation shifts over time.
How do professionals level uneven concrete foundations? Experts typically use techniques such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am lifting to restore proper levelness.
Is concrete leveling a disruptive process? Concrete leveling is generally minimally invasive and designed to be completed with minimal disruption to the property.
How can I tell if my concrete foundation needs leveling? Signs include cracks, uneven surfaces,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.
